Check for Access Information



To start rodent-proofing your attic, examine for entrance points. Begin by meticulously examining the outside of your home, seeking any type of openings that rats might utilize to gain access to your attic. Look for voids around utility lines, vents, and pipes, in addition to any splits or openings in the foundation or home siding. See to it to pay very close attention to locations where various building products fulfill, as these prevail entry factors for rats.

In addition, examine the roofing system for any kind of damaged or missing out on shingles, in addition to any spaces around the edges where rats could press with. Inside the attic room, search for signs of existing rodent activity such as droppings, ate wires, or nesting materials. Make use of a flashlight to thoroughly check dark edges and surprise areas.

Seal Cracks and Gaps



Check your attic extensively for any fractures and spaces that require to be secured to avoid rodents from entering. Rodents can squeeze through also the tiniest openings, so it's critical to secure any type of potential entry points. Check around pipes, vents, cords, and where the walls fulfill the roof. Make use of a mix of steel woollen and caulking to seal these openings effectively. Steel woollen is a superb deterrent as rats can not chew through it. Guarantee that all gaps are snugly secured to reject access to undesirable parasites.

Don't overlook the significance of sealing gaps around doors and windows too. Usage weather condition stripping or door sweeps to secure these locations efficiently. Inspect the areas where energy lines get in the attic room and secure them off using a suitable sealer. Get Rid Of Food Sources



Take positive steps to get rid of or keep all prospective food resources in your attic to discourage rodents from infesting the area. Rats are attracted to food, so removing their food sources is important in keeping them out of your attic.

Right here's what you can do:

1. ** Shop food firmly **: Stay clear of leaving any food products in the attic room. Store all food in airtight containers constructed from steel or durable plastic to prevent rodents from accessing them.

2. ** Clean up particles **: Eliminate any type of piles of debris, such as old newspapers, cardboard boxes, or wood scraps, that rats can make use of as nesting product or food resources. Maintain the attic room clutter-free to make it much less enticing to rats.

3. ** Dispose of rubbish appropriately **: If you use your attic for storage space and have rubbish or waste up there, make sure to throw away it consistently and effectively. Rotting garbage can bring in rodents, so maintain the attic clean and devoid of any kind of organic waste.
